Background

Blockchain technology, initially conceived for cryptocurrencies like Bitcoin, has matured significantly. Its decentralized and secure nature has attracted interest beyond finance, with applications emerging in supply chain management, healthcare, and digital identity verification.

However, limitations in scalability and interoperability have hindered mainstream adoption. High transaction fees and slow processing speeds have been significant hurdles, alongside the lack of seamless communication between different blockchain networks.

What’s New

Recent breakthroughs are addressing these challenges. Layer-2 scaling solutions, such as rollups and state channels, are significantly increasing transaction throughput without compromising security. These solutions process transactions off-chain before committing them to the main blockchain, reducing congestion.

Furthermore, advancements in cross-chain communication protocols are enabling interoperability between different blockchain networks. This allows data and assets to be seamlessly transferred between various systems, creating a more interconnected and collaborative ecosystem.
